NV-1200 SHV-M Fume cupboard without a cabinet with a table top made of chipboard
NV-1200 SHV-M Fume cupboard without a cabinet with a table top made of chipboard
from 35 150 ₽
NV-1200 SHV-M is the most low-budget exhaust cupboard of the NV line. It is single-frame, with a laminated countertop. It is intended mainly for analytical laboratories. External dimensions of the cabinet (W×D×H): 1100×700×1960 mm. Dimensions of the working area (W×D×H): 1068×540×750 mm. Table top: laminated chipboard. A minimalistic solution for your laboratory The NV-1200 SHV-M fume cupboard has a minimum of functions, which makes it the most inexpensive. The table top is made of laminated chipboard. It is relatively moisture-resistant, resistant to short-term exposure to acids, alkalis and organic solvents. This countertop does not tolerate strong heating or prolonged exposure to solvents, concentrated acids and alkalis. The working area is closed by one lifting frame with a counterweight. It has two exhaust zones: the hood of the exhaust box and the level of the countertop. Diameter of the flange for connection to the ventilation system: 150 mm. Working area size (W×D×H): 1068×540×750 mm. Please note that the cabinet narrows upwards. At a height of 50 cm, the depth of the working area will be 410 mm, and at a height of 70 cm: 365 mm. If you need to place high equipment, then make sure that it corresponds to the dimensions of the camera, otherwise you will not be able to close the cabinet. The height of the raised glass above the cabinet: 510 mm, that is, with the glass raised, the total height of the cabinet will be 2470 mm. The working area is illuminated by a fluorescent lamp (included in the package). The switch is located on the right side of the cabinet body. The base of the cabinet is made on an all-welded metal frame in powder coating. The side laminated panels (chipboard 16 mm thick) are edged on the facade with a durable PVC edge 2 mm thick, which increases their impact resistance and mechanical strength. The cabinet legs are adjustable in height within two centimeters, allowing you to place the cabinet even on a fairly uneven floor. And what are the other options? In the line of NV-1200 cabinets there is a cabinet with plumbing and a surface made of granite tiles, as well as cabinets without plumbing, and with a surface made of monolithic ceramics, stainless steel, chemically resistant plastic. They are exactly the same size as the NV-1200 SHV-M. If you need a minimalistic cabinet of large sizes, you could be interesteed in the NV-1500 SHV-M model.

MNPVO prefix with a zinc selenide element and an integrated visualization system on an external monitor
MNPVO prefix with a zinc selenide element and an integrated visualization system on an external monitor
The main difference between this set-top box and the universal set-top box of the NPVO and ZDO is that a prism is used as a working element of the MNPVO, which allows to obtain several reflections from the area of contact with the sample under study, which leads to an improvement in the quality of the spectrum and an increase in the sensitivity of the method (absorption bands become more pronounced). The registration of specular and diffuse reflection spectra (ZDO) is not provided on this set-top box. The MNPVO prefix is effective in registering the absorption spectra of samples whose dimensions (number) are sufficient to ensure contact with the entire area of the working face of the prism: * liquids of any degree of viscosity (solutions, suspensions, oils, etc.); * solid elastic samples (polymer fragments of sufficiently large size, rubbers, plastics, etc.); * powdered samples in quantities sufficient to be applied to the entire surface and samples in the form of thin tapes; The universal clamp is equipped with a precision lever mechanism for quickly lowering the tip and a micrometer screw that allows you to pre–set the optimal degree of pressure - this ensures quick sample change and repeatability of the results during measurements. For convenience when working with liquid and paste-like samples, it is possible to rotate the clamping console by 180o. Note: the MNPVO prefix does not exclude the possibility of registering the spectra of samples whose dimensions are smaller than the area of the working face of the prism (the presence of a visual inspection system of the surface under study increases convenience when working with small-sized objects), but the overall effectiveness of the method is significantly lower than when using the universal NPVO and ZDO prefix. Transmission in the operating range of the spectrum, % of the input signal of at least 25 · The recommended number of scans when registering spectra is 25 · Spectrum registration time at 25 scans (resolution 4 cm-1), 30 seconds · The depth of penetration of radiation into the sample, microns 5 – 15 · Minimum area of a solid sample, mm2 1 · Minimum volume of the test liquid, ml 0.3 · The permissible pH range of the analyzed objects is from 5 to 9 · Crystal substrate material ZnSe CVD, Ge · Diameter of the focus spot, mm 3 · Number of reflections 3 · The size of the working face of the prism, mm 21 X 6 · Magnification of the 4X micro lens · Total magnification of the visual channel 75X · Field of view of the optical system, mm 2 X 2.5 · Digital video camera resolution 640 X 480 · Overall dimensions, mm 145×125×240 · Weight, kg 2
